May 2009

May 9: Mayer Power Equipment Annual Open House

May turned out to be a great month with three main events to focus on. First up was the Mayer Power Equipment annual open house (May 9). Mayer, an independent STIHL retailer located in the Boston area, put together the open house mainly as a social event to bring the tree care community together for food, music, fun and a little education.

I helped out with the education part of the open house by demonstrating a few common felling techniques in a cozy, interactive setting. What made it enjoyable for me was the interaction and discussions that developed as we progressed.

May 13: Northeastern Associates Open House

Next, was another open house event on May 13, but this time in my home state of New Jersey. This event was very similar to the Mayer open house, only Northeastern Associates decided to focus their educational component on electrical hazards. To do this, they brought in the local power company and its mobile display trailer.

Seeing a demonstration like this can be life saving. They walked through the different types of lines, insulators, voltage amounts and more. It is always an eye opener to get such top-rate speakers delivering a powerful presentation to those who need it the most.

May 25-31: Norway

The last event of the month was a biggie – Norway. Svein Ringheim organized a terrific event in Voss, Norway where twenty climbers converged to learn how to work with cranes to perform tree removals. Next was a one-day climbing event in the port city of Bergen.

In Voss, we started indoors the evening before the outdoor workshop, to give an overview of how we would progress and also to discuss theory.

The site was perfect–picturesque and logistically sound. We had a row of ten trees in a lakeside park that needed to be removed without damaging the newly planted trees that were to take their place. The size of the trees was ideal, as well, because they were mature but not huge. They allowed us to have each student perform the rigging and cutting of both brush and wood. And since we had the ability to utilize two cranes over a two-day period, we could spend a lot of quality time in the air with each student.

STIHL Norway was a contributing sponsor. Without their assistance, the event might not have happened at all.
